Specification Comparison
| Parameter | MSP430F2121IRGETSource | TPS54200DDCT | AD9837ACPZ-RL7 | MSP430F2121IRGER | MSP430F2101TRGET | MSP430F2131IRGER | MSP430F2111IRGER |
|---|---|---|---|---|---|---|---|
| Manufacturer | Texas Instruments | Texas Instruments | Analog Devices | Texas Instruments | Texas Instruments | Texas Instruments | Texas Instruments |
| Package Type | Quad Flat No-Lead | SOT23 (6-Pin) | Small Outline No-lead | Quad Flat No-Lead | Quad Flat No-Lead | Quad Flat No-Lead | Quad Flat No-Lead |
| Pin Count | 24 | 6 | 10 | 24 | 24 | 24 | 24 |
| Temperature Range | -40.0°C ~ 85.0°C | -40.0°C ~ 85.0°C | -40.0°C ~ 125.0°C | -40.0°C ~ 85.0°C | -40.0°C ~ 105.0°C | -40.0°C ~ 85.0°C | -40.0°C ~ 85.0°C |
| Price | $1.2002 | $0.8210 | $2.4400 | $1.0500 | $0.6758 | $1.5100 | $0.8866 |
| Electrical Parameters | |||||||
| Pbfree Code | Yes | Yes | No | Yes | Yes | Yes | Yes |
| YTEOL | 15 | 15 | 10 | 15 | 0 | 15 | 15 |
| Has ADC | NO | — | — | NO | NO | NO | YES |
| Additional Feature | ALSO OPERATES AT 1.8V MINIMUM SUPPLY AT 6 MHZ | — | — | ALSO OPERATES AT 1.8V MINIMUM SUPPLY AT 6 MHZ | ALSO OPERATES AT 1.8V MINIMUM SUPPLY AT 6 MHZ | ALSO OPERATES AT 1.8V MINIMUM SUPPLY AT 6 MHZ | — |
| Bit Size | 16 | — | — | 16 | 16 | 16 | 16 |
| Boundary Scan | YES | — | — | YES | NO | YES | YES |
| CPU Family | MSP430 | — | — | MSP430 | MSP430 | MSP430 | MSP430 |
| Clock Frequency-Max | 16 MHz | — | — | 16 MHz | 16 MHz | 16 MHz | 16 MHz |
| DAC Channels | NO | — | — | NO | NO | NO | NO |
| DMA Channels | NO | — | — | NO | NO | NO | NO |
| Format | FIXED POINT | — | — | FIXED POINT | — | FIXED POINT | FIXED POINT |
| Integrated Cache | NO | — | — | NO | — | NO | NO |
| JESD-30 Code | S-PQCC-N24 | R-PDSO-G6 | S-PDSO-N10 | S-PQCC-N24 | S-PQCC-N24 | S-PQCC-N24 | S-PQCC-N24 |
| JESD-609 Code | e4 | e3 | e3 | e4 | e4 | e4 | e4 |
| Low Power Mode | YES | — | — | YES | — | YES | YES |
| Number of I/O Lines | 16 | — | — | 16 | 16 | 16 | 16 |
| Number of Timers | 16 | — | — | 16 | — | 16 | 16 |
| On Chip Data RAM Width | 8 | — | — | 8 | — | 8 | 8 |
| On Chip Program ROM Width | 8 | — | — | 8 | 8 | 8 | 8 |
| PWM Channels | YES | — | — | YES | YES | YES | YES |
| Package Body Material | PLASTIC/EPOXY | PLASTIC/EPOXY | PLASTIC/EPOXY | PLASTIC/EPOXY | PLASTIC/EPOXY | PLASTIC/EPOXY | PLASTIC/EPOXY |
| Package Equivalence Code | LCC24,.16SQ,20 | — | SOLCC10,.12,20 | LCC24,.16SQ,20 | LCC24,.16SQ,20 | LCC24,.16SQ,20 | LCC24,.16SQ,20 |
| Package Shape | SQUARE | RECTANGULAR | SQUARE | SQUARE | SQUARE | SQUARE | SQUARE |
| Package Style | CHIP CARRIER, HEAT SINK/SLUG, VERY THIN PROFILE | SMALL OUTLINE, THIN PROFILE, SHRINK PITCH | SMALL OUTLINE, HEAT SINK/SLUG, VERY THIN PROFILE | CHIP CARRIER, HEAT SINK/SLUG, VERY THIN PROFILE | CHIP CARRIER, HEAT SINK/SLUG, VERY THIN PROFILE | CHIP CARRIER, HEAT SINK/SLUG, VERY THIN PROFILE | CHIP CARRIER, HEAT SINK/SLUG, VERY THIN PROFILE |
| Peak Reflow Temperature (Cel) | 260 | 260 | 260 | 260 | 260 | 260 | 260 |
| Qualification Status | Not Qualified | — | Not Qualified | Not Qualified | Not Qualified | Not Qualified | Not Qualified |
| RAM (bytes) | 256 | — | — | 256 | 128 | 256 | 128 |
| RAM (words) | 0.25 | — | — | 0.25 | — | 0.25 | 0.125 |
| ROM (words) | 4096 | — | — | 4096 | 1024 | 8192 | 2048 |
| ROM Programmability | FLASH | — | — | FLASH | FLASH | FLASH | FLASH |
| Speed | 16 MHz | — | — | 16 MHz | 16 MHz | 16 MHz | 16 MHz |
| Supply Current-Max | 0.41 mA | — | — | 0.41 mA | 0.41 mA | 0.41 mA | 0.41 mA |
| Supply Voltage-Max | 3.6 V | 28 V | — | 3.6 V | 3.6 V | 3.6 V | 3.6 V |
| Supply Voltage-Min | 3.3 V | 4.5 V | — | 3.3 V | 3.3 V | 3.3 V | 3.3 V |
| Supply Voltage-Nom | 3.3 V | — | — | 3.3 V | 3.3 V | 3.3 V | 3.3 V |
| Surface Mount | YES | YES | YES | YES | YES | YES | YES |
| Technology | CMOS | — | — | CMOS | CMOS | CMOS | CMOS |
| Temperature Grade | INDUSTRIAL | INDUSTRIAL | AUTOMOTIVE | INDUSTRIAL | INDUSTRIAL | INDUSTRIAL | INDUSTRIAL |
| Terminal Finish | Nickel/Palladium/Gold (Ni/Pd/Au) | Matte Tin (Sn) | Matte Tin (Sn) | Nickel/Palladium/Gold (Ni/Pd/Au) | NICKEL PALLADIUM GOLD | Nickel/Palladium/Gold (Ni/Pd/Au) | Nickel/Palladium/Gold (Ni/Pd/Au) |
| Terminal Form | NO LEAD | GULL WING | NO LEAD | NO LEAD | NO LEAD | NO LEAD | NO LEAD |
| Terminal Pitch | 0.5 mm | 0.95 mm | 0.5 mm | 0.5 mm | 0.5 mm | 0.5 mm | 0.5 mm |
| Terminal Position | QUAD | DUAL | DUAL | QUAD | QUAD | QUAD | QUAD |
| Time@Peak Reflow Temperature-Max (s) | 30 | 30 | 30 | 30 | 30 | 30 | 30 |
| uPs/uCs/Peripheral ICs Type | MICROCONTROLLER, RISC | — | — | MICROCONTROLLER, RISC | MICROCONTROLLER, RISC | MICROCONTROLLER, RISC | MICROCONTROLLER, RISC |
